## Scrubjay Environments

Scrubjay strips EXIF from all uploaded images before storage. Three environments: dev, staging, prod. Staging mirrors prod traffic at 10%. Never promote a build that fails the metadata-leak check. Prod cutover requires sign-off from release management. Each environment overrides the base settings; the prod values are listed below.

config for kagup-hahig:
druwyn:
  pin: 2801
  metrics_host: metrics.druwyn.zemvarlabs.internal
  tenant: sorius
  seal: seal_798a43d7

## Transcode Farm — 2.14

Good news: the Flickermill farm now scales workers off queue depth instead of a cron guess, so those Friday-night backlogs should stop. We also bumped the default preset ladder and killed the ancient 240p rung nobody watched. Heads up for release: rollout needs a drain of in-flight jobs, roughly 20 minutes. If anything looks off during the window, loop in the engineer accountable for this release.

named custodian: Brivan Eliath Quenox Frador

Minutes — Management Meeting, Expansion Review

Present: heads of department.

Decision: proceed with entry into the Veltmark region. Site shortlist narrowed to Corbeny and Ashlow. Hiring freeze lifted for regional roles. Halden to deliver logistics costing by month-end. Marketing holds launch work pending site choice. Next review in two weeks. The confidential note on business plans follows immediately below.

board note of bawep-tajef: Queniusek Systems plans to raise the Quenvan list price by 53.1 percent in March. The pricing group signed off on a budget of $176.4 million for Project Drueth. The renewal with Casionix Partners closes at $142.5 million a year, 8.3 percent below the last contract. Project Fraax slips by six weeks because of the tooling delay.

### Fan out weather alerts in batches

Hey folks — this PR reworks how Stormlet pushes severe-weather alerts to subscribers. Instead of one publish call per user (ouch), we now batch by region shard and fan out through the Quillcast queue with bounded concurrency. Net effect: a county-wide alert goes out in ~3s instead of ~40s. New teammates: the batching knobs live in one place now, so please don't scatter magic numbers. Here are the defaults we landed on.

tuning constants:
QUOTAS = {
    "druwyn": 5,
    "holix": 5,
    "zorath": 5,
    "holwyn": 10,
}